I'm just a poor ignorant rookie and had this situation last night.

A1 is dribbling just past the division line toward his basket. He picks up his dribble and momentum causes him to touch the ball to the floor while holding the ball with both hands. So he's got both feet on the ground, and the ball is touching the ground with both hands on the ball. Is there a call? Can you please cite chapter & verse?
4-15-4 Note 3, It is a dribble when a player stands still and bounces the ball. It is not a dribble when a player stands still and holds the ball and touches it to the floor once or more than once. (From 2001-02 rule book)
